Ordinals
beta
Sat 343831726157150
decimal
68766.1726157150
degree
0°68766′222″1726157150‴
percentile
16.37293935882691%
name
lkkqozdntnf
cycle
0
epoch
0
period
34
block
68766
offset
1726157150
timestamp
2010-07-17 22:08:10 UTC
rarity
common
prev
next